Name: Heterochromatin protein 1-binding protein 3 (HP1BP3), Rat, ELISA Kit Price: 724.00 Size: 1 Kit Catalog number: GBS-E0082
Buy online
© 2010 - 2024 by Chromatine. Design by ProBootstrap:Resto. All Rights Reserved.